Creamy stilton pasta

This is probably my all time favourite recipe that I have come up with and I have spoken about it many times it makes me think that I have blogged it before so I apologise in advance if I have because I can't seem to find it. just a shame I can't eat blue cheese at the moment but guess this could work with a strong crumbly cheese like a Lancashire cheese.

Ingredients
 Healthy Extra of stiliton cheese, I use a garlic and mushroom white stilton that I get from a local market
Quark
Vegatables of your choice I used peppers, onions and mushrooms.
Herbs
Pasta

1. Crumble the stilton in the quark overnight so that the quark can absorb all the flavour.
2. Cook the pasta
3. Fry up vegetables and herbs
4. Drain pasta and combine all the ingredients

Creamy Pasta Bake

So after getting all my data from my broken computer I realised that I had a lot of recipes and food pictures that I haven't blogged so here is the first it's a creamy pasta bake. As usual I don't tend to weigh anything unless it's synned or a healthy extra so I have no measurements.


Ingredients


Pasta
Chopped Tomatoes
Any veg of your choice
Italian Oxo Cube
Garlic
Chilli
Quark
Healthy Extra A of cheese


1. Boil pasta until aldente
2. Fry vegetables together with garlic and chilli, add chopped tomatoes, oxo cube and herbs and simmer.
3. Once this is done stir in some quark (if you don't like this then you can leave it out or use a healthy extra of philidelphia cheese)
4. Combine all ingredients together and place in an oven proof dish.
5. Place in the oven on about 160 for 20 minutes, adding grated cheese to the top for the last 5 minutes of cooking. It's is done when cheese is melted and pasta had a crunchy top.
6. Serve with a salad

Simple Strawberry Yoghurt Baseless Cheesecake

Ingredients
1/2 tub of quark
1 sachet of Wicked White Options Hot Chocolate
1 Strawberry Yoghurt



1. Place all ingredients into a tub


2. Mix well  and place into the fridge for an hour. Then enjoy!




2 syns on all plans
